How's Dammam better than rest of KSA ? Any specific benefits / advantages for a non Muslim expat ?

ghanshyampdave wrote:

How's Dammam better than rest of KSA ? Any specific benefits / advantages for a non Muslim expat ?


The coasts are less conservative than the interior. They also have the sea!聽 You can swim, fish, dive.聽 Also, there are many expats in the Dammam area due to Aramco and additionally, it's convenient to Bahrain!
